The interplay between lipids and the immune system in atherosclerosis
Cardiovascular diseases are among the most frequent causes of death in the world. The main underlying pathology of cardiovascular diseases is the development of atherosclerosis in the medium and large-sized arteries.

Chemical genetics strategy to profile kinase target engagement reveals role of FES in neutrophil phagocytosis, Nat. Comm. 2020
Chemical tools to monitor drug-target engagement of endogenously expressed protein kinases are highly desirable for preclinical target validation in drug discovery. Here, we describe a chemical genetics strategy to selectively study target engagement of endogenous kinases.
